Frequently Asked Questions about Estero

How much are Studio apartments in Estero?

There are currently 21 Studio Apartments in Estero with rent ranges from $1,360 to $1,620 with an average price of $1,446.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Estero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Estero ranges from $795 to $2,583 with an average monthly rent of $1,697.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Estero c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Estero range from $1,295 to $6,690.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,077.

How expensive are Estero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 33 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Estero on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$860 to $6,330 - averaging $2,830 for the location.
